HOA-free and family-oriented in Coral Springs
“North Springs is a great neighborhood to grow up in,” says Richard Ruiz, a Realtor with Blue Realty. “It’s a very family-oriented area. My first-ever listing there was actually for my friend’s parents. I grew up in Coral Springs. I went to all the same schools as the kids in North Springs. I had friends there. I lived like 10 minutes down the road, so I’d go over all the time to hang out. My brother and I played baseball at North Spring Community Park.” North Springs is a community on the north side of Coral Springs, with amenity-rich parks, excellent schools and proximity to the Sawgrass Expressway. Another major draw of this suburb is that it’s HOA-free. This saves homeowners money and allows them to make their properties their own.
Spanish Revivals
Properties in North Springs were developed in the late 1980s and ‘90s. All houses are Spanish Revivals, featuring stucco siding, clay roof tiles and arches. Most have four bedrooms or more. “These were all custom homes at the time,” Ruiz says. “Not those cookie-cutter homes that are copy-paste, copy-paste right on top of each other. You have lots up to 15,000 square feet.” List prices range from $500,000 to $1.1 million. Townhouses and condos are in the neighborhood, too, priced between $180,000 and $380,000.

Homeruns at Marjory Stoneman Douglas High
North Springs is served by Broward County Public Schools. Local students take their first major academic steps right in the neighborhood at Country Hills Elementary, rated B-plus on Niche, and Coral Springs Middle, rated B. Marjory Stoneman Douglas High is close to home, too, rated A-plus and ranked No. 8 on Niche’s list of Broward County’s best public high schools. Part of the reason for Marjory Stoneman Douglas High’s A-plus rating is its extensive selection of clubs and activities. From publishing poems in the school’s literary art magazine, Artifex, to volunteering at local animal shelters with the Animal Care Club, students can go down plenty of extracurricular avenues. Students can also enrich their high school days with athletics. “Douglas has a strong baseball team, that’s for sure,” Ruiz says. “A decent amount of kids go far. One of my friends’ younger brothers will be going major soon. He plays for the Baltimore Orioles’ Triple-A team. Anthony Rizzo went to Douglas; he plays for the Yankees, one of the best teams out there.”

Betti Stradling Park
North Community Park is the neighborhood’s largest recreational hub, spanning nearly 40 acres. It features several athletic facilities, including soccer/lacrosse fields, baseball/softball fields, tennis courts, basketball courts and a sand volleyball court. The park’s parking lot is sizable but fills up quickly on weekends, so new residents should know to get there in the morning for a spot. Those living in the Yardley Estates subdivision avoid parking entirely and just walk over. Similarly, residents on the south side of North Springs — say, in the Brookside Court subdivision — walk or bike to Betti Stradling Park. Although smaller, this green space is jam-packed with amenities, including Princess Meadow’s Playground, an area for children of all ages, especially little ones, to enjoy the slides, swings and musical instruments. The city also recently installed a new “splash-n-play” area.

Moon Thai & Japanese Restuarant
North Springs Plaza and Magnolia Shoppes are in the neighborhood off North University Drive. Together, they offer a movie theater, restaurants, and staple stores such as Target, Ross, Office Depot and Dollar Tree. Moon Thai & Japanese is a popular chain restaurant with a location in Magnolia Shoppes. The picturesque presentation of its flavorful dishes complements its upscale decor.

The Coral Springs Holiday Parade
Annually, the Coral Springs Holiday Parade brings folks from all corners of the city to Sample Road. “I’ve been going to the Christmas parade since I was a kid,” Ruiz says. “All local Coral Springs businesses show up. They parade around Sample Road, throwing candy. Our company, Blue Realty, is always in it, throwing candy, too.” More than 60 floats, full of festive costumes and fun displays, take a trip down the road all the way to City Hall.

The Sawgrass Expressway
North Springs is a car-dependent community. Residents benefit from proximity to the Sawgrass Expressway, accessed by a ramp less than a mile from the neighborhood. I-95, the beach and the FLA Live Area, where the Florida Panthers play, are all within 15 miles.

North Springs Demographics and Home Trends
On average, homes in North Springs, Coral Springs sell after 68 days on the market compared to the national average of 52 days. The median sale price for homes in North Springs, Coral Springs over the last 12 months is $757,750, down 1%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
